Zhoug Chicken Thighs
With zhoug, a hot Middle Eastern cilantro sauce, chicken thighs are baked. This recipe requires only 4 ingredients and only 5 minutes to prepare before baking.
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Grease a 9×9-inch baking dish with olive oil.
Measure 1/2 cup of prepared zhoug and spread over the bottom of the oiled baking dish.
Place chicken thighs cut side down on top of the zhoug.
Sprinkle fire-roasted bell peppers over chicken thighs.
Using a spoon drop remaining zhoug sauce in between the bell pepper pieces covering as much of the chicken thighs as possible.
Bake in the preheated oven until chicken is no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ear about 45 minutes.
An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).
